Model
- Network Architecture
-
fixed: each neuron in each layer is connected to two neurons
in the previous layer, output of it is a square function of
inputs. One neuron of the last layer is selected for ourput.
The network is generated automatically, the user has no control
over the network generation.
- Paradigms
-
- Limitations
-
150 or fewer tupels of input data with a maximum of 24 input variables.
network type fixed (see above).
number of nodes and number of connections limited by DOS memory (640k)
